From Pele and Diego Maradona to Eric Cantona and George Best, the 50 most influential players in football history have been revealed.

Viv Anderson has been named as one of the most influential footballers of all time alongside the likes of David Beckham, Lionel Messi, Cristiano Ronaldo and Ronaldinho.

The 65-year-old ex-defender enjoyed a prolific club career and lifted two European Cups under legendary former Nottingham Forest manager Brian Clough.

Anderson, who ended his decade-long spell at Nottingham Forest in 1984, went on to play for the likes of Arsenal, Manchester United and Sheffield Wednesday at club level.

However, the Nottingham Forest legend forever etched his name in the history books by becoming the first black player to represent England.

FourFourTwo compiled the star-studded list of football legends, which included the likes of Zinedine Zidane, Antonin Panenka, Diego Maradona and Johan Cruyff.

According to the football magazine, Anderson was “not a token pick” for the Three Lions and he was widely tipped to “become an England legend.”

They added that the former defender’s England shirt from his first appearance against Czechoslovakia in 1978 is displayed at the People's History Museum in Manchester.

Beckham made the top 50 alongside fellow Manchester United legends Eric Cantona and George Best.

FourFourTwo pointed to the 46-year-old Inter Miami president’s success both on the pitch and off it, saying he was “arguably the biggest-ever English celebrity footballer.”
